Download presentation
Presentation is loading. Please wait.
Published byCurtis O’Connor’ Modified over 9 years ago
1
The UNIVERSITY of NORTH CAROLINA at CHAPEL HILL Joystick Anselmo Lastra
2
The UNIVERSITY of NORTH CAROLINA at CHAPEL HILL 2 Atari 2600 Joystick (have 2-3) http://www.atariarchives.org
3
The UNIVERSITY of NORTH CAROLINA at CHAPEL HILL 3 We Have Sega Joypads Enhanced version with more buttons Has mux Select pin chooses first or second set of buttons, L/R http://pinouts.ru/data/genesiscontroller_pinout.shtml
4
The UNIVERSITY of NORTH CAROLINA at CHAPEL HILL Six Button Use See ♦ http://www.cs.cmu.edu/~chuck/infopg/segasix.txt http://www.cs.cmu.edu/~chuck/infopg/segasix.txt Use select to use buttons B & C To use X, Y, Z, need to pulse select 4
5
The UNIVERSITY of NORTH CAROLINA at CHAPEL HILL NEXYS Mappings (PMOD JA) SignalFPGA PinDB-910- Pin UpM1514 DownL1723 LeftL1638 RightK1242 Btn A/BM1469 Start/CL1591 SelectM16710 Ground-85 Power-56 5 PMOD JA is 10-pin connector nearest VGA connector
6
The UNIVERSITY of NORTH CAROLINA at CHAPEL HILL Suggestion Create FF for Select ♦ Memory map so you can set from CPU Memory map the input signals ♦ I would not latch them Please power off when plugging or unplugging Sega joypads! Careful when plugging in PCB 6
7
The UNIVERSITY of NORTH CAROLINA at CHAPEL HILL 7 Links http://pinouts.ru/data/JoystickAtari2600_pinout.shtml http://pinouts.ru/data/genesiscontroller_pinout.shtml http://www.epanorama.net/documents/joystick/ataristick.ht mlhttp://www.epanorama.net/documents/joystick/ataristick.ht ml http://www.epanorama.net/documents/joystick/tvgames.html http://www.cs.cmu.edu/~chuck/infopg/segasix.txt
Similar presentations
© 2025 SlidePlayer.com. Inc.
All rights reserved.